import { Button, Form, Input } from "antd"; import React from "react"; import { useTranslation } from "react-i18next"; import { connect } from "react-redux"; import { createStructuredSelector } from "reselect"; import { loginStart } from "../../redux/tech/tech.actions"; import { selectLoginError, selectTechnician, } from "../../redux/tech/tech.selectors"; import "./tech-login.styles.scss"; const mapStateToProps = createStructuredSelector({ technician: selectTechnician, loginError: selectLoginError, }); const mapDispatchToProps = (dispatch) => ({ loginStart: (user) => dispatch(loginStart(user)), }); export function TechLogin({ technician, loginError, loginStart }) { const { t } = useTranslation(); const handleFinish = (values) => { loginStart(values); }; return (